Output a8627929a07f26e50b10759cba81dc500b93e152bc9fa5b545a8ece4e3d67952:80

value
171439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d969e6736dcf15e49b0c44cd1cd523e6145e6c OP_EQUAL
address
3MTcL9RAC34HoZNiDhw7YdSvDir4q8p3qE
transaction
a8627929a07f26e50b10759cba81dc500b93e152bc9fa5b545a8ece4e3d67952
spent
true